Developing a Photographic Food Portion Atlas: Key Components Creating an effective
photographic atlas involves meticulous planning, standardization, and cultural
consideration. Here’s a step-by-step guide to its development: 1. Selection of Food Items
Identify common foods and dishes in Dubai, including: - Traditional Emirati dishes (e.g.,
Shawarma, Machboos, Samboosa) - Popular international foods (e.g., Burgers, Sushi,
Pasta) - Snacks and desserts (e.g., Luqaimat, Kunafa) - Beverages (e.g., Juices, coffee, soft
drinks) - Fruits and vegetables frequently consumed 2. Defining Portion Sizes Establish
standard portion sizes based on local consumption patterns and dietary guidelines. For
each food item, include: - Small portion - Medium portion - Large portion Alternatively,
define specific weights (e.g., 100g, 200g) and volume measures (e.g., 1 cup, 1 bowl). 3.
Photography Setup and Standards Ensure consistency across images: - Use a neutral,
uncluttered background - Include a common reference object (e.g., a standard-sized plate,
a coin, or a ruler) for scale - Capture images from a top-down and at an angle to illustrate
volume - Use uniform lighting to avoid shadows and distortions 4. Visual Representation
Display each portion alongside: - A common household item or reference object - Exact
weight or volume measurements - A comparison with a standard measuring utensil 5.
Cultural and Presentation Considerations Reflect local serving styles, garnishes, and
presentation to make the atlas relatable. Include traditional dish presentations where
possible. --- Practical Applications of the Food Portion Atlas in Dubai Dietary Counseling

Enhance their understanding of balanced portions --- Sample Food Items and Their
Photographic Representation Below is an illustrative list of typical Dubai foods included in
the atlas, with suggested portion sizes and visual cues. Emirati Dishes - Machboos (Spiced
Rice with Meat) - Small: 1 cup (~200g) - Medium: 1.5 cups (~300g) - Large: 2 cups
(~400g) - Luqaimat (Sweet Dumplings) - 3 pieces (~50g) - 6 pieces (~100g) - 12 pieces
(~200g) International Favorites - Grilled Chicken Burger - Small: 100g patty (~1/4 lb) -
Medium: 150g (~1/3 lb) - Large: 200g (~1/2 lb) - Sushi Roll (Salmon) - 6 pieces (~150g) -
12 pieces (~300g) Snacks and Sweets - Sambousa (Samosa) - 1 piece (~50g) - 3 pieces
(~150g) - Kunafa (Sweet Pastry) - Small slice (~100g) - Large slice (~200g) Fruits and
Vegetables - Fresh Dates - 2 dates (~50g) - 5 dates (~125g) - Salad (Mixed Greens) - 1
cup (~50g) - 2 cups (~100g) --- Designing the Atlas: Best Practices Standardization To
